Watch TV Travel Man's Greatest Trips Season 1 on 123movies

« Season 0 | See All Seasons/Episodes | Season 2 »

Travel Man's Greatest Trips Season 1

Richard Ayoade raids the Travel Man archive to look back on some of his greatest trips.

Starring:

Genre:


Travel Man's Greatest Trips - Seasons/Episodes


Watch Travel Man's Greatest Trips 123movies for free in HD quality. Stream instantly with English subtitles — no download or account needed.